Job Title
Trainee Geoscientist
Job Description
The candidate shall be responsible for
- Developing mapping and prospect evaluation skills
- Participating in value adding meetings, presentations, exhibitions, conferences and lectures that enhance business and knowledge.
- Carrying out 3D seismic interpretation
- Building subsurface framework for geologic modeling
- Assisting other more experienced geoscientists in conducting surface and subsurface data analysis
- Obtaining exposure to field studies, Formation evaluation, well-site operations, Seismic data acquisition/ processing, Project management, New Field Development etc
- Developing the relevant skills in identifying and recommending drilling opportunities
- Participating in duties at well-sites
- Performing other duties as assigned from time to time by the supervisor.
The candidate is required to possess the following
- A Ph.D. or Masters degree in the Geosciences (Geology or Geophysics). Candidates who are expecting to obtain a Ph.D. or Masters degree by October 2011 may also apply
- A Bachelors degree with at least a second class upper in the Geosciences (Geology, Geophysics, or physics)
- Excellent computer skills
- A clear understanding of basic Geoscience concepts and principles
- NYSC discharge or exemption certificate
- Experience at a geoscience workstation will be an added advantage
